CNC Turning of 1045 Steel Drive Shaft for the Lawn & Garden Industry
Ashley Ward manufactured a series of driveshafts to be used within a garden tiller application. Using our advanced CNC turning operations, we produced 20,000 driveshafts for the lawn and garden industry, successfully meeting all client specifications. We also performed spline rolling to form the cylindrical body of each component.
Upholding a precision tolerance of (±) .001 of an inch, we manufactured each driveshaft to measure precisely 1.25 inches in outer diameter. Constructed from 1045 steel material, we provided each unit with a smooth, 32 RMS finish. After ensuring that we met client expectations for design and quality, we then delivered all 20,000 units to our customer's facility in Ohio.
With the ability to provide high-quality, precision machining operations, we were able to complete this project within a short, 8-10 week turnaround period. Fulfilling all of our client's requirements, we have been able to supply this part for many years.
